Check your undertones. When
choosing a pink, use your skin as a
guide, says Lobell. Those with pink tones should go for a
blue-based pink. Yellow tones require a warmer,
browner shade. “If you’re shy, choose one with a sheer,
glossy texture,” she adds. For Wilde, Lobell used YSL
Rouge Pure lipstick in Pink Orchid, a blue-based pink.
Starting at the bow of the lips and moving out toward the
edges, she used a lip brush to apply two coats of the color.
